WebSome gate drivers may not be able to operate at 100% duty cycle (e.g., if using a bootstrap capacitor in a high-side gate driver, the cap will eventually bleed down to 0V). You can generally run an IGBT continuously within its safe operating area - review voltage, current, and thermal ratings.

WebIn electronics, duty cycle is the percentage of the ratio of pulse duration, or pulse width (PW) to the total period (T) of the waveform. It is generally used to represent time duration of a pulse when it is high (1). In digital electronics, signals are used in rectangular waveform which are represented by logic 1 and logic 0. WebSo as duty cycle is more the average DC voltage supplied to motor is more and so speed of motor is increased. So as duty cycle is varied by varying on and off time of chopper, the speed of motor can be varied.
